What is the difference between 'quiet' and 'quite'?

'Quiet' means making little or no noise, while 'quite' means to a certain extent or degree.

What is the correct way to write 'revolutionary war'?
Back
'Revolutionary War' should be capitalized as it is a proper noun.

How do you show possession for a singular noun like 'Zoey'?
Back
You add an apostrophe and 's' to the end, making it 'Zoey’s'.

When should you use a comma in a sentence?
Back
A comma is used to separate items in a list or to indicate a pause in a sentence.

What is a sentence fragment?
Back
A sentence fragment is a group of words that does not express a complete thought.
